Thud and Blunder: Fantasy Skirmish Wargaming Rules

Thud & Blunder is a fantasy skirmish wargame that focuses on narrative campaigns, warband customization, and quick, accessible gameplay using D10s. It is a versatile “toolbox” system allowing players to create diverse, small-scale warbands (5-20 figures) for dungeon-delving or open-battle scenarios in any setting.

Key Features and Mechanics

  • System: Uses a D10-based system adapted from In Her Majesty’s NameBlood Eagle, and Daisho.
  • Gameplay: Fast-paced with a focus on scenario-driven, narrative play rather than just competitive slaughter.
  • Warbands: Players typically manage 5 to 20 models, focusing on heroes with specific skills, traits, and weapons.
  • Customization: A detailed, open points system enables players to create custom warbands, ranging from wizards to orc raiders.
  • Rules: Includes comprehensive rules for, shooting, fighting, armor, magic, and, and environmental effects.
Core Components
  • Rules: The 164-page hardback book contains all necessary rules for combat and campaign progression.
  • Scenarios: Features 20+ scenarios, including dungeons, in urban or rural settings.
  • Customization: Allows for extensive character building, with figures having 5 basic attributes (race, destiny, shooting, fighting, speed).
  • Versatility: The system is not tied to a specific world, allowing it to be used for various fantasy themes.|

Genre: Fantasy
Scale: 28 mm
Average Models per Side: Less than 10, 10 to 20
Number of Players: 2, 2+
Miniatures: Agnostic
Rules: Purchased PDF or Rulebook
Availability: In Print
Publisher: The Ministry of Gentlemanly Warfare
Designers: Craig Cartmell, Charles Murton
Year Released: 2019
